linux查看端口情况
时间: 2023-04-21 18:04:41 浏览: 63
可以使用以下命令来查看Linux系统中的端口情况:
1. netstat命令:可以查看当前系统中所有的网络连接情况,包括监听的端口和已经建立的连接。
2. lsof命令:可以查看当前系统中所有打开的文件和网络连接情况,包括监听的端口和已经建立的连接。
3. ss命令:可以查看当前系统中所有的网络连接情况,包括监听的端口和已经建立的连接,与netstat类似,但是更加高效。
4. nmap命令:可以扫描指定IP地址或者主机名上的所有端口,以及判断这些端口是否开放。
以上命令都可以在终端中使用,需要具有管理员权限才能执行。
相关问题
linux查看端口占用情况
可以使用以下命令查看Linux系统上的端口占用情况:
1. netstat命令
可以使用netstat命令来查看当前系统的网络连接状态和端口占用情况。下面是一些常用的netstat命令:
- 查看所有的TCP连接:`netstat -at`
- 查看所有的UDP连接:`netstat -au`
- 查看所有的网络连接:`netstat -a`
2. ss命令
ss命令是netstat的替代品,速度更快,显示的信息更详细。下面是一些常用的ss命令:
- 查看所有的TCP连接:`ss -t`
- 查看所有的UDP连接:`ss -u`
- 查看所有的网络连接:`ss -a`
3. lsof命令
lsof命令用于列出当前系统打开的文件和进程信息。可以使用lsof命令来查看指定端口的占用情况。下面是一个查看80端口占用情况的例子:
`lsof -i :80`
以上这些命令都可以用来查看Linux系统上的端口占用情况。
linux查看端口开放情况
可以使用以下命令来查看Linux系统中端口的开放情况:
1. netstat命令:可以查看当前系统中所有的网络连接和端口状态,包括已经建立的连接和监听状态的端口。
2. lsof命令:可以列出当前系统中所有打开的文件和进程,包括网络连接和监听状态的端口。
3. nmap命令:可以扫描指定IP地址或主机名的端口,以确定哪些端口是开放的。
以上三个命令都可以用来查看Linux系统中端口的开放情况,具体使用方法可以参考相关命令的帮助文档。